The desolation of the genre
I never saw this place before it was ruins, so I don’t know what it used to be. Maybe a small motel? A roadhouse? A private residence?
Whatever it was, it’s got a lot of company. Just a little ways down the road is this abandoned motel , and back in the other direction is what’s left of the Hi-Way Cafe.
Roadside businesses seem to have fallen on hard times.
near Marfa, Texas
photographed 8.16.2013

#1 Fans
Do you qualify as a #1 Fan of the Dallas Cowboys? No, I don’t either. But if we DID, this is where we could hang out. There are some rules, though, according to the numerous hand-written signs taped to the door. You have to be over 21 to enter. You have to fork over a five buck cover charge. And you can smoke only in “desenated” areas, which are further defined as “in back.”
E. Geneva Street
Slaton, Texas
photographed 1.25.2013
